Abstract Background People living with heart failure (HF) often experience significant physical and psychological symptom burden, which impair quality of life and contribute to adverse outcomes, including hospital readmissions. Purpose To (a) identify latent profiles of symptom burden in patients with HF and (b) examine their associations with hospital readmission. Methods This is a secondary analysis from the MIGHTy-Heart study, a pragmatic comparative effectiveness trial evaluating mobile integrated health interventions among patients with HF. Latent Profile Analysis (LPA) was conducted using items from the PROMIS-29 (fatigue, anxiety, pain interference, physical function, and ability to participate in social activities) to identify subgroups of symptom burden. A three-class symptom burden solution was selected (AIC = 101,543, BIC = 101,711, entropy = 0.782, minimum class probability = 0.883), labeled as Low (n=339), Moderate (n=851), and High (n=762) symptom burden. Cox proportional hazards models were used to examine time to hospital readmission at 30, 60, and 90 days, with symptom burden class as key predictor. Models were adjusted for sex, age, treatment arm, and Charlson comorbidity index. Results Among 1,911 patients (median age=67 years, 47% Black, 52% female), comorbidities included hypertension, diabetes, and chronic kidney disease. In adjusted models, at 60 days, patients in the Moderate symptom burden class had a 31% higher hazard of readmission compared to those in the Low burden class (aHR=1.311, 95% CI=1.023 – 1.679). At 90 days, the hazard remained elevated (aHR=1.270, 95% CI=1.021–1.580). The High symptom burden class did not show increased hazards of readmission at any time point neither in adjusted nor unadjusted models. Conclusions Symptom burden may be a useful clinical marker for readmission risk, particularly when symptoms are modestly elevated but not yet severe. Nurses should closely monitor patients with moderate symptom burden who may otherwise go unnoticed. While high symptom burden may be of concern for clinicians, further research should explore why it does not necessarily translate into higher risk of readmission.
